Taxonomic Classification

Rank Borneo Fruit Bat Mexican Flameknee
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Arachnida (Arachnids)
Order Chiroptera (Bats) Araneae (Araneae)
Family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) Theraphosidae
Genus Aethalops Brachypelma
Species Aethalops aequalis Brachypelma auratum

Evolutionary Relationship

Borneo Fruit Bat and Mexican Flameknee share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
